Does he have a turbo trainer to train indoors? My dh is also cycling mad and found this great to train when the kids are in bed and I'm out. You could get one in your budget. Dh has an all singing all dancing one that connects to the computer and allows him to virtually do tour De France climbs. That was about £300 so more than you were looking for though!

If he has one already how about a box set to watch while on it?

If he mostly does road cycling what about a session at a velodrome? Or if track cycling a mountain biking session?

Or if you have small kids and he struggles to find time a book of vouchers made by you promising him a number of days out?
